karmada icon indicating copy to clipboard operation
karmada copied to clipboard

add proxy skeleton

Open ikaven1024 opened this issue 3 years ago • 4 comments

Signed-off-by: yingjinhui [email protected]

What type of PR is this? /kind api-change /kind feature

What this PR does / why we need it: Implement for proxy

Which issue(s) this PR fixes: Fixes #

Special notes for your reviewer:

Does this PR introduce a user-facing change?:

users can request global resource by api: /apis/search.karmada.io/v1alpha1/search/proxy/...

e.g. list all the pods across clusters:
kubeclt get --raw /apis/search.karmada.io/v1alpha1/search/proxy/api/v1/pods

ikaven1024 avatar Aug 11 '22 14:08 ikaven1024

@RainbowMango is the api is appropriate?

ikaven1024 avatar Aug 11 '22 15:08 ikaven1024

cc @XiShanYongYe-Chang I'll look at it later.

RainbowMango avatar Aug 12 '22 04:08 RainbowMango

ok

XiShanYongYe-Chang avatar Aug 12 '22 10:08 XiShanYongYe-Chang

The release-note may need to be updated.

XiShanYongYe-Chang avatar Aug 17 '22 13:08 XiShanYongYe-Chang

[APPROVALNOTIFIER] This PR is APPROVED

This pull-request has been approved by: RainbowMango, XiShanYongYe-Chang

The full list of commands accepted by this bot can be found here.

The pull request process is described here

Needs approval from an approver in each of these files:

Approvers can indicate their approval by writing /approve in a comment Approvers can cancel approval by writing /approve cancel in a comment

karmada-bot avatar Aug 18 '22 00:08 karmada-bot